Transaction f1584d073e6cf95e41a0c0b4ee65537af601634d84183b45fe70f598c9766be7

1 Input
2 Outputs
  • f1584d073e6cf95e41a0c0b4ee65537af601634d84183b45fe70f598c9766be7:0
  • value  5655000
    address  32h63kAhChUDnNaDuPRUL6JRwGXgGFvXEH
  • f1584d073e6cf95e41a0c0b4ee65537af601634d84183b45fe70f598c9766be7:1
  • value  2094214
    address  18P6bJcvXYDp6ZegMpJ6VR4idithY3gASG